How Free Spins Work on Book of Oz
Book of Oz runs on a 5x3 reel set with 10 fixed paylines, and its bonus round follows the classic 'book slot' template popularized by titles in this genre. The book symbol carries a dual role: it substitutes for other symbols as a wild and also acts as the scatter that unlocks the free spins round when three or more appear anywhere on the grid.
Once triggered, the round introduces an expanding special symbol. During the free games, one symbol is selected to expand and cover an entire reel whenever it lands, which can produce full-reel matches across the fixed paylines. This is the mechanic that gives book-style bonus rounds their reputation for spikier, more concentrated payouts compared to the base game.
There is no bonus buy option on Book of Oz. Some competing titles let players pay a multiple of their stake to jump straight into a bonus round; this game does not offer that route, so the free spins can only be reached organically through scatter landings during regular play.
A separate mechanic worth noting is the paid respin feature, which lets a player pay to respin an individual reel outside of the free spins round. According to the provider, using this feature shifts the theoretical return from 96.31% in the base game up to 96.50%. It's a distinct system from the free spins trigger and doesn't affect how the bonus round itself is entered.
Because the game carries a high to very high volatility rating and a stated maximum win of 5,000x stake, the free spins round is the primary vehicle for larger multipliers on this title. Between triggers, the base game and respin feature carry the session, which is typical of book-style slots built around a single concentrated bonus mechanic.
Casino-run free spins promotions are unrelated to this in-game structure. When an operator offers spins on Book of Oz as part of a welcome package or ongoing promotion, those spins are simply pre-loaded base-game spins at a set stake — they don't change how the book scatter or expanding symbol behave once the round is reached.

Free Spins Feature Details
- Triggered by landing 3 or more book scatter symbols on the reels
- Book symbol doubles as a wild in the base game, substituting for standard symbols
- One symbol is selected to expand and cover a full reel throughout the free spins round
- Paid respin feature lets a player pay to respin a single reel independently of the free spins trigger
- Fixed 10-line structure across 5x3 reels applies during both base game and free spins
- No bonus buy — the free spins round cannot be purchased directly

Frequently Asked Questions
Can you buy the free spins round directly on Book of Oz?
No. There is no bonus buy feature on this title. The only way to enter the free spins round is by landing 3 or more book scatter symbols during regular play.
How many book scatters trigger the bonus round?
Three or more book symbols anywhere on the 5x3 grid trigger the free spins round.
Does the expanding symbol during free spins change every round?
One symbol is selected to expand and cover a full reel for the duration of that free spins session, following the classic book-slot bonus format.
Does using the paid respin feature affect the RTP?
Yes. The provider states a base RTP of 96.31%, rising to 96.50% when the paid respin feature is used.
Are casino free spins promotions the same as the in-game bonus round?
No. A casino's free spins offer is a promotional credit at a fixed stake, separate from the scatter-triggered bonus round built into the game itself.
Is Book of Oz confirmed to carry free spins offers on Canadian-licensed casino sites?
Not definitively. Availability of promotions on this title is set by individual operators, and no complete Canada-wide list of qualifying sites has been verified.
Can you test the free spins mechanic without a promotional offer?
Yes. Demo versions of Book of Oz are available on multiple review and casino sites, allowing the scatter trigger and expanding symbol to be tested without a deposit.
Does Book of Oz Lock 'n Spin use the same free spins mechanic?
No. Book of Oz Lock 'n Spin is a separate sequel title from Triple Edge Studios with its own reported RTP and mechanics, distinct from the original Book of Oz.
